[Bug 1163043] [NEW] Directory Desktop stays in English in the Live CD's
Public bug reported: Hi, After testing Lubuntu Precise, Xubuntu Precise, I have been able to test also Ubuntu Raring as of todays daily built and Xubuntu Raring of today's daily built, and found the same in each of these versions. What happens : I boot to Live, choose my language, then once on the desktop, I seek for the default directories in the home of the user : and in this *Live* environment all the directories are in my language except "Desktop" which is still having for name "Desktop". What is expected: I would be expecting the directory "Desktop" to be in my locale in the Live CD's/ Live USB/ Live vitual machines... What happens after install : in all the versions tested, all directories, *including* the directory "Desktop" are renamed the right way. I wish that the Desktop directory be also in the relevant locale in the Live versions, if it is possible to fix it. [Bug 2020211] [NEW] .sudo_as_admin_successful not created as domain user
Public bug reported: When running a command as "sudo", an empty file ".sudo_as_admin_successful" is supposed to be created in the user's home directory. The problem occurs only on domain accounts, local accounts do generate the file ".sudo_as_admin_successful".
